Brain scans reveal how alcohol changes Decision-Making

NCT ID NCT02108054

First seen Nov 21, 2025 · Last updated May 18, 2026 · Updated 16 times

Summary

This study aims to create simple computer tasks that measure thinking, motivation, and decision-making in people with alcohol use disorder and healthy volunteers. Participants will complete tasks either inside or outside an MRI scanner to see how the brain works. The goal is to develop better tools for future research, not to provide treatment. About 400 right-handed adults aged 18-65 are needed.
